Dear Sir / Ma'am, Pursuant to the Securities and Exchange Board of India Circular No. HO/38/13/11(2)2026-MIRSD- POD/1/3750/2026 dated January 30, 2026, a Special Window has been opened for a period of one (1) year commencing from February 05, 2026 and ending on February 04, 2027, for the transfer and dematerialization (“Demat”) of physical securities which were sold or purchased prior to April 01, 2019 and which were rejected, returned, or remained unattended due to deficiencies in documentation, procedural requirements, or otherwise, and also in cases where such securities could not be lodged for transfer prior to April 01,2019, in the manner prescribed under the aforesaid Circular. Accordingly, the concerned investors are hereby advised to lodge or re-lodge, as the case may be, the transfer deeds along with all requisite documents, duly completed in all respects, in strict compliance with the provisions of the said Circular, with the Registrar and Transfer Agent (“RTA") of the Company.
